Manulife AM names first ESG research head

The Canadian asset manager has poached Emily Chew from index provider MSCI for the global role in Hong Kong, amid rising asset owner interest in sustainable investing.
Manulife AM names first ESG research head
Canada’s Manulife Asset Management has appointed its first global head of environmental, social and corporate governance research and integration and located her in Hong Kong, reflecting a growing trend among institutional investors in Asia to focus on ESG factors. Emily Chew, formerly Asia-Pacific head of ESG research at index provider MSCI, took up the role last month.
